Overview
As an Account Executive on the Toyota Dealer Association business, you will work closely with the Regional TDA Account Management and Media Teams.
Success for this position is measured by the ability to ensure all account management fundamentals are flawlessly executed, so that the team is buttoned up and can function as seamlessly as possible across all projects. It is imperative this person is detail-oriented, a team player and is positive!
Responsibilities
Roles and Responsibilities include:
- Attends client, internal and partner meetings.
- Management of the following tasks:
- Social jobs/trafficking.
- Email communications.
- Radio jobs/trafficking.
- Point of sale production/install.
- Sales & registration competitive analysis.
- TDA partnership & activations including off-site promotions, ticketing, vehicle logistics, stadium assets, etc.
- Client communications: dealer group and Board.
- Monthly Client meeting logistics.
- Website QA.
- Assists Account Supervisor and Management Director with various client deliverables.
- Assists Management Director with Client meeting preparation and logistics.
- Assists Account Supervisor with client financial responsibilities.
Qualifications
Qualifications:
- Professionalism and positive, can-do attitude throughout all tasks big and small
- Organized, detail-oriented, and thorough
- Ability to juggle multiple projects simultaneously
- Understands how to prioritize tasks across multiple projects
- Meeting preparedness and ability to troubleshoot issues effectively
- Eager to learn & take on new responsibilities; looks for opportunities to support team and business wherever possible
- Proactively seeks solutions to problems, but knows when to ask for help/guidance
- Ability to take feedback well and incorporate it quickly and effectively
- Proactively Manages UP and ACROSS teams (over-communication is much preferred to not communicating at all)
- Builds trust and respect from external team members (e.g., other internal departments, partner agencies, clients)
Requirements:
- 2-3 years agency or client facing account service experience
- Position is hybrid, with in-office time required.
- Thorough knowledge of Microsoft Word, Teams, Excel, and Keynote.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Client contact will be involved, and an understanding of the Client’s business is essential.
- Highly detail oriented.
